Mouthwatering Korean Beef Bulgogi Recipe for Cozy Nights

Enjoy a delicious Korean Beef Bulgogi recipe, perfect for cozy nights, blending savory flavors with tender beef for a satisfying meal.
Prep Time 30 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Total Time 40 minutes
Servings: 4 servings
Course: Dinner
Cuisine: Korean
Calories: 450

Ingredients
  

Beef Marinade
  • 1/4 cup soy sauce low sodium is a good option
  • 2 tablespoons sugar you can adjust based on preference
  • 2 cloves minced garlic fresh garlic for best flavor
  • 1 tablespoon sesame oil adds rich flavor
  • 1 tablespoon grated ginger fresh ginger enhances the taste
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
Beef and Vegetables
  • 1 pound ribeye or sirloin beef thinly sliced against the grain
  • 1 medium onion thinly sliced
  • 2 medium carrots thinly sliced
  • 1 tablespoon oil for cooking
  • 2 tablespoons sesame seeds for garnish
  • 2 stalks green onions sliced for garnish

Equipment

  • Skillet
  • Mixing bowl
  • grill

Method
 

Preparation
  1. Preheat your grill or stovetop skillet over medium-high heat.
  2. In a mixing bowl, combine soy sauce, sugar, minced garlic, sesame oil, grated ginger, and black pepper to create the marinade.
  3. Whisk until the sugar is dissolved.
  4. Thinly slice your beef against the grain and place it in the marinade.
  5. Let the beef marinate for at least 30 minutes.
Cooking
  1. Remove the beef from the marinade and let any excess liquid drip off.
  2. Heat a little oil in your skillet over medium-high heat.
  3. Add the beef slices in a single layer, cooking for 2-3 minutes on each side.
  4. Remove the beef and add sliced onion and carrots to the skillet.
  5. Sauté until slightly tender, about 2-3 minutes.
  6. Return the cooked beef to the skillet and toss to combine.
  7. Cook together for an additional minute.
  8. Serve hot, garnished with sesame seeds and green onions.

Notes

For optimal flavor, marinate beef for longer if possible. Add other vegetables based on preference.
